[QUOTE="sonic blue l, post: 1070095, member: 5185"] The next step would be a manual compression test, if the relative passed and showed the same after a few tries, then realistically you could get away with only doing one cylinder on each bank. (Help keep costs down) If the op doesn't know, basically a relative compression test is the scan tool monitoring crankshaft speed while the engine is cranked over (without running) thus a low compression cylinder will cause a speed increase in the crankshaft). This is why it's called relative as it only compares the cylinders to one another, but does not actually tell you what the compression is. This is why you can have a worn out/dusted engine that will pass a relative compression test. Now have a hole in a piston, damaged valves, broken rocker arm , etc and it will flag that cylinder. (Well in theory as I've had it pick the wrong cylinder before, but that's not that's not really the point as a failure of relative just means one should perfom a manual test to verify, just like how high crankcase pressure needs to be verified with a manual compression to either condem or rule out base engine) [/QUOTE]
